Expected Worth in Gambling Games


When discussing gambling games, one of the basic ideas rooted in math is the anticipated value. This numerical metric helps players grasp the potential results of their wagers over a period. In basic terms, expected value (EV) calculates the mean amount a player can expect to win or suffer per bet if they were to play the game repeatedly. Each activity has its unique EV, influenced by the probabilities and the casino advantage, which indicates the benefit that the gambling establishment holds.


For instance, consider a activity like roulette. The expected worth can be derived based on the specific bet made. If a gambler bets on a single number, the return is 35 to 1, but the true odds of winning that wager are 1 in 37 (in European roulette). This leads in a negative expected value, indicating that, on the whole, gamblers will incur a loss money over time when playing this kind of wager. Grasping this idea allows gamblers to make better educated choices about which games and bets may be less advantageous.


Additionally, the investigation of expected value can lead to better money management. Gamblers who understand the math behind their activities are often able to set realistic expectations. By acknowledging their possible deficits and profits, they can adjust their playing strategies appropriately, which may improve their overall gambling experience overall. As a result, anticipated worth serves as a critical resource for both novice and seasoned gamblers to navigate the frequently volatile character of casino activities.
